Output 6d6261ca6761c3443f1fc5ad0f6527fd55308625b82faa39f5a7e15f06c057d1:1

value
21684334
script pubkey
OP_0 OP_PUSHBYTES_20 50374e93dd61b842d818609739c713f120d689db
address
ltc1q2qm5ay7avxuy9kqcvztnn3cn7ysddzwmy3a7xg
transaction
6d6261ca6761c3443f1fc5ad0f6527fd55308625b82faa39f5a7e15f06c057d1
spent
true